Fuses
Fuses, by definition, are cylindrical or tubular, low resistance devices designed to melt and thereby break an electrical circuit when a predetermined current flow is exceeded. Used effectively in the circuit protection process, fuses are the first line of defense against excessive currents that can cause harsh damage to delicate circuitry and related components.
